gpt4 book ai didi

python - 报告 qweb 未显示

转载 作者:太空宇宙 更新时间:2023-11-04 10:22:58 26 4
gpt4 key购买 nike

我是报告 qweb 的新手,我想练习它,然后我尝试为我的模块 gestion_des_etudiants 创建报告,我知道我的代码中缺少一些东西,我需要你的帮助:

report_etudiant.xml

<?xml version="1.0" encoding="utf-8"?>
<!--Custom report.-->
<openerp>
<data>
<template id="report_etudiant_document">
<t t-call="report.external_layout">
<div class="page">
<div class="row">
<h3>Teeeeeeeeeeeeest</h3>

</div>
</div>
</t>
</template>
<template id="report_etudiant">
<t t-call="report.html_container">
<t t-foreach="doc_ids" t-as="doc_id">

<h3>Tiiiiiiiiiiiiiiiiiiiiitle</h3>

</t>
</t>
</template>


</data>
</openerp>

学生报告.xml:

<?xml version="1.0" encoding="utf-8"?>
<openerp>
<data>
<report
id="action_report_etudiant"
string="Attestation de scolarité"
model="etudiant"
report_type="qweb-pdf"
name="gestion_des_etudiants.report_etudiant"
file="gestion_des_etudiants.report_etudiant"
/>
</data>
</openerp>

当我打印报告时,我得到一个空的 pdf 文件,没有错误但为空,甚至没有页眉或页脚

最佳答案

您没有调用您的report_etudiant_document 模板来显示您需要的内容,所以在您的t-foreach 中你需要添加这一行:

编辑:

<t t-raw="translate_doc(doc_id, doc_model, 'gestion_des_etudiants.report_etudiant_document')"/>

希望对您有所帮助!

关于python - 报告 qweb 未显示,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31187335/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com